Growth and Recognitions

By embracing Kia's new brand slogan, “Movement that inspires”, and advocating new energy vehicles, the SKT team increased brand presence through various experiential events. They successfully enhanced the quality of offerings and built mutual trust and relationships with dealers.

Under Calvin’s purview, Kia became the fastest-growing CBU brand in Taiwan driven by the ‘Can-Do’ team spirit. Notably, it has won consecutively the top prize ‘Taiwan Car of the Year’ awards with the Kia EV6 in 2023 and the Kia EV9 in 2024. The SKT team’s efforts have garnered international recognition from Kia APAC, receiving honours such as the "2022 Most Innovative Market," "Best Brand Launch Campaign," "Best Product Launch-EV6 and Sportage," and "Excellence in EV Leadership" from Kia, with Taiwan being one of the only three countries awarded worldwide.

 

Embracing Corporate Responsibility

Reflecting SKT’s commitment to Sime’s purpose in delivering sustainable futures, the team is committed to corporate social responsibility (CSR), and in making contributions to the nation. Among the recent initiatives, SKT partnered with Lee-Ming Institute of Technology to establish an “EV Talent Development Center,” with the aim of nurturing the next generation of electric vehicle experts and engineers. SKT also actively supports the development of children in remote areas, forging partnerships with food banks and youth organisations, providing donations to support underprivileged groups and the next generation, such as Hualien Meilun Junior High School football matches, King of Mountain (KOM) cycling tournaments and ironman races.
